Understanding the UK Driving License Categories
Before diving into the application procedure, it is important to comprehend the different categories of driving licenses offered in the UK:
Provisional License
A provisionary license permits people to learn to drive and is the important initial step for brand-new drivers.
Secret Features:
- Valid for approximately 10 years
- Permits drivers to practice with an approved instructor or a qualified driver over 21
- Must display 'L' plates on the automobile
Full License
When individuals have actually passed their driving exam, they can get a full driving license, allowing them to drive unaided.
Key Features:
- Valid forever, subject to renewal requirements
- Various classifications based on vehicle types (e.g., motorbikes, cars and trucks, heavy automobiles)
Categories of Vehicles
Depending upon the particular driving license held, people may be qualified to operate numerous kinds of vehicles:
- Category A: Motorcycles
- Classification B: Cars
- Category C: Large automobiles (trucks)
- Category D: Buses
Step-by-Step Process to Obtain a Driving License
Acquiring a UK driving license involves several necessary actions, which are described as follows:
1. Obtain a Provisional License
The journey starts by applying for a provisionary license, which can be done online or by means of a postal application.
Requirements:
- Age: Must be at least 15 years and 9 months old
- Identity Verification: UK residency proof (passport, utility bill)
- Payment of Fee: Typically around ₤ 34 online or ₤ 43 by post
2. Prepare for the Theory Test

3. Take the Theory Test
The theory test consists of two elements: multiple-choice concerns and a danger understanding test.
Bottom line:
- Candidates should pass both sections to continue to the useful driving test
- The cost of the theory test is approximately ₤ 23
4. Practical Driving Lessons
After passing the theory test, the next step involves taking practical driving lessons with a qualified trainer.
Suggestions:
- Take lessons with an Approved Driving Instructor (ADI)
- Aim for a minimum of 20-40 hours of useful lessons, depending on individual capabilities
- Practice routinely with a certified driver
5. Pass the Practical Driving Test
When the instructor thinks the prospect is ready, they can reserve their useful driving test.
Test Components:
- A vision test
- Automobile security concerns (revealing knowledge of the lorry)
- On-road driving skills evaluation within a set amount of time
6. Get Your Full Driving License
Upon successfully passing the practical test, prospects can apply for their complete driving license. If certified, the trainer will submit the necessary documentation electronically, or prospects can apply straight through the DVLA.
Requirements:
- Payment of the essential charges (approx. ₤ 34 for online applications)
- Provide a passport-sized photograph, if not digitally submitted
Additional Considerations
Medical Requirements
Particular drivers, especially those with medical conditions, might need to reveal their health status. This may involve extra evaluations before getting a license.
Rejection of License
There are specific situations under which a license application can be refused, consisting of:
- Failure to fulfill proposed age limitations
- Previous disqualifications due to driving offenses
- Medical reasons that might impair driving capability
Frequently asked questions
What is the minimum age to get a provisional license in the UK?
The minimum age to get a provisionary driving license is 15 years and 9 months old.
For how long does it take to get a driving license in the UK?
The timeline can vary substantially based on individual readiness, availability of driving test slots, and other elements. Usually, it might take a number of months to finish the process, from acquiring a provisional license to passing the practical test.
Can I drive without a full driving license in the UK?
No, it is unlawful to drive a vehicle without a valid full driving license. However, provisional license holders can practice driving under specific guidelines, such as being accompanied by a qualified driver.

What occurs if I fail my useful driving test?
Candidates can retake the practical test after a waiting duration. It is suggested to take extra lessons to enhance before attempting the test once again.
